Abstract
The high temperature creep and fatigue behavior of the precipitate hardened ferritic Fe-19Cr-4Ni-2Al alloy were investigated. Results showed that nickel aluminide was formed upon the addition of nickel to Fe-Cr-Al alloys. The formation of these precipitates improved the mechanical properties of these Ni based superalloys at elevated temperatures.
